Early Life and Career

Song Hye Rim's story begins in Changnyeong County, South Gyeongsang Province, in what is now South Korea, on January 21, 1937. In the whirlwind of history, her family found themselves migrating north, eventually settling in North Korea. Can you imagine the journey and the changes she must have experienced? Life took an artistic turn for Song Hye Rim when she pursued acting, a path that led her to become a renowned actress. Her talent and beauty shone brightly in the North Korean film industry, making her a recognizable face and a celebrated artist. This was a time when North Korean cinema was a powerful tool for the state, and Song Hye Rim was one of its stars. Relationship with Kim Jong-il

Okay, now for the juicy part! Song Hye Rim's life took a dramatic turn when she caught the eye of Kim Jong-il. This was a clandestine affair, shrouded in secrecy. Kim Jong-il, who at the time was climbing the ranks within the ruling Workers' Party of Korea, was known for his love of the arts and cinema, which is likely how their paths crossed. Their relationship was far from straightforward. Song Hye Rim was already married with a child when she met Kim Jong-il, adding layers of complexity and secrecy to their burgeoning romance. This was not a relationship that could be openly celebrated; it was a carefully guarded secret, hidden from the prying eyes of the public and, more importantly, from Kim Il-sung, Kim Jong-il's father and the Supreme Leader of North Korea.

Their relationship was a closely guarded secret, primarily because Kim Il-sung reportedly disapproved of Song Hye Rim due to her being previously married and her family background. The Birth of Kim Jong-nam

From their relationship came a son, Kim Jong-nam, born in 1971. This event should have been a joyous occasion, but it was also fraught with complications. Kim Jong-nam's birth was kept secret for a long time, primarily because of Kim Il-sung's disapproval of the relationship. This secrecy had significant implications for Kim Jong-nam's future. As the firstborn son of Kim Jong-il, he was naturally seen as a potential heir to the North Korean leadership. However, the circumstances of his birth and the disapproval of his grandmother, Kim Il-sung's wife, placed him in a precarious position.

Later Life and Death

As time went on, the relationship between Kim Jong-il and Song Hye Rim began to fray. The pressures of secrecy, the political machinations within North Korea, and Kim Jong-il's own complex personality all contributed to the strain. Song Hye Rim's mental health suffered, and she reportedly spent significant time seeking medical treatment abroad, particularly in Moscow. Song Hye Rim eventually passed away in Moscow in 2002. Her death marked the end of a life lived in the shadows, a life filled with both privilege and profound sadness.
